Project Overview

The Montana Department of Transportation (MDT) and Knife River are rehabilitating approximately 2 miles of US 93 north of Reserve Drive in Kalispell. The project area begins at the intersection of US 93 and Reserve Drive and extends north 2 miles.

Planned Improvements Include:

  • Resurfaced roadway.
  • Chip seal, cover, and fog seal.
  • New pavement markings.
  • New signage.
  • Upgraded guardrail.
  • Shoulder rumble strips.
  • Updated barrier ends on Stillwater River bridge.

Project Overview

The Montana Department of Transportation (MDT) and LHC Inc. are rehabilitating seven roadways in the Kalispell urban area. Five of these project areas will be resurfaced, and are less than 1 mile in length. Two of the project areas will be chip sealed and covered and are more than 1 mile in length. This project will preserve the existing pavement and extend the service life of the existing asphalt surfaces. The project areas include East Reserve Drive, West Evergreen Drive, Airport Road, Conrad Drive, Woodland Park Drive, Whitefish Stage Road, and Woodland Avenue.
